Srinagar Jan 4 (KNS) : JKPC Spokesperson Hamid Rather, an advocate and entrepreneur, on Monday called on JKPC President Sajad Lone at his residence in Sonwar and held a detailed discussion on issues confronting the people of Jammu and Kashmir, with a special focus on youth-related concerns.
In a statement issued, The meeting deliberated at length on the reservation policy, rising unemployment, exorbitant electricity bills, and the long-pending issues of daily wagers, besides other pressing public grievances.
